Overview
Group 1 Honda Greenbelt is part of the fast-growing Group 1 Automotive , a leader in automotive retail. We are looking for a full-time Master Technician / Shop Foreman to join our team.
As a Master Technician / Shop Foreman , you will lead the daily operations of the Mechanical Shop, ensuring timely, high-quality, and efficient repairs while supporting the training, development, and performance of our technicians.
Responsibilities
Recruit and retain technicians to maintain appropriate shop staffing.
Optimize workflow and dispatch repair orders to meet customer and production goals.
Ensure proper use and compliance with DMS and Xtime.
Monitor technician performance, productivity, and repair quality.
Provide hands-on diagnostic and repair support as needed.
Maintain and enforce Quality Control standards.
Ensure technicians remain current on required training and Honda certifications.
Support technician progression through Maintenance, Repair, and Diagnostic certification levels.
Ensure compliance with Warranty, Safety, Compliance, and KPA requirements.
Maintain shop equipment in safe, proper working condition.
Perform other duties as assigned by Service Management.
Qualifications
5+ years experience as a automotive technician is required
Honda or Acura Master Certified strongly preferred
Proficient with dealership systems and processes (CDK experience a plus)
Proven leadership and communication skills
High school diploma or equivalent.
Valid Maryland driver's license and a good driving record
Compensation: The expected compensation for this position is $120,000 - $150,000 annually , based on experience, qualifications, and market conditions

Overview
Group 1 Toyota Certified Capital Plaza is looking for a motivated and customer-focused Automotive Service Advisor to join our growing team. This role is ideal for individuals who thrive in a fast-paced environment, enjoy building customer relationships, and are passionate about delivering an exceptional service experience.
Responsibilities
Schedule and confirm appointments to ensure smooth customer experience
Create transparent repair orders with accurate cost and time estimates
Communicate with technicians and parts team to guarantee timely service completion
Provide regular updates to customers on the status of their vehicle
Maintain strong product knowledge to assist with service needs and warranty information
Qualifications
Automotive dealershipService Advisor experience is required.
Must be available to work Saturday's
Positive & Friendly Attitude
Interpersonal Communication skills
Strong desire to provide an exceptional client experience
Ability to achieve targeted goals
High School Diploma or equivalent
Must have a Valid Driver’s License
Compensation: The compensation for this position is wholly commission-based. As a result, compensation may vary based on several factors, including individual performance and market conditions. The range in yearly compensation reasonably expected for this position is $60'000 - $100,000 / a year .
